Output 171e41dbc80bbf76b1c30e13bfa419fec060250136f183e3e8ef229e85680eb2:1

value
37888000
script pubkey
OP_0 OP_PUSHBYTES_20 7a963e335606dd0db870351b4e12532753f5801e
address
bc1q02truv6kqmwsmwrsx5d5uyjnyafltqq7wcdfwl
transaction
171e41dbc80bbf76b1c30e13bfa419fec060250136f183e3e8ef229e85680eb2